Luis Reyes, the founder of Iberian Ventures and a former Bain consultant, shares his remarkable journey from rural Mexico to spearheading a fire safety roll-up in Spain. He discusses his aggressive acquisition strategy, achieving $8 million in EBITDA through 24 consolidations. Luis emphasizes the role of AI in enhancing operational efficiency and navigating the complexities of merging various business models. He also reflects on the unique challenges of the European investment landscape and shares insights into fostering leadership within SMEs.

ANECDOTE

From Founder And Consultant To Roll-up

  • Luis Reyes left consulting to build roll-ups after founding a SaaS startup earlier in his career.
  • He moved to Spain to apply integration and M&A skills to fragmented SMEs.
ANECDOTE

Hire Hungry Junior Operators Early

  • Luis Reyes hired a 25-year-old analyst while still employed to research sectors and run outreach.
  • The junior ran outreach, built LBOs and owned deal work before leaving to start his own firm.
INSIGHT

Spain's SME Fragmentation Fuels Opportunity

  • SMEs account for around 65% of Spain's GDP, creating many small, fragmented targets.
  • That fragmentation produces more roll-up opportunity than in the U.S. or northern Europe.
